    In 1979 there were about 400 dental consultants in hospital services, mostly based in the 17 undergraduate dental hospitals and one post-graduate institute. [24] In 1948 only 19% of twelve-year-olds had no significant dental decay but in 2003 this had risen to 62%. In 2015 only 6% of the population had no natural teeth. [1]

    With indemnity dental plans, the insurance company generally pays the dentist a percentage of the cost of services. Restrictions may include the co-payment requirements, waiting period, stated deductible, annual limitations, graduated percentage scales based on the type of procedure, and the length of time that the policy has been owned.

    John M. Harris started the world's first dental school in Bainbridge, Ohio, and helped to establish dentistry as a health profession. It opened on 21 February 1828, and today is a dental museum. [15] The first dental college, Baltimore College of Dental Surgery, opened in Baltimore, Maryland, US in 1840.
